About JPEG to PCX Conversion

Converting JPG to PCX is a common task for many users, especially those who work with graphics and images. The PCX format, also known as Paintbrush, is an old raster image format that was widely used in the 1980s and 1990s. Although it has been largely replaced by more modern formats like JPEG, PNG, and GIF, it is still used in some niche applications.

The main reason to convert JPG to PCX is to maintain compatibility with older systems or software that only support the PCX format. Additionally, some users may prefer the PCX format for its simplicity and small file size.
